Product Description Explode into the game with these tough football cleats from adidas. Smooth faux leather upper in an athletic technical football cleat style, with abrasion resistant adiTUFF(R) toe overlay, adidas signature 3 side stripes, mesh panels, stitching and perforation accents and protective heel overlay. Full lace up front, padded tongue and collar, soft mesh lining. Cushioning insole, shock absorbing midsole. Durable, 14 cleat Traxion(R) outsole for multi-direction traction.
Amazon.com Product Description adidas' Corner Blitz 7 D Mid football shoes for men feature durable, lightweight synthetic leather uppers, a combination of lace-up and a hook-and-loop closure along the vamps, injected EVA mid-soles for added cushioning and injected TPU detachable cleat out-soles for a winning combination of comfort and performance. Get the grip and support you need on the field with these dynamic football shoes.

Good Shoe at a decent price November 15, 2007 J. D. Baker (West Sacramento, CA) Nice shoe at a reasonable price. Lightweight and comfortable. Don't know about durability, but they seem to be holding up well after three games. My son is a senior, varsity football player who goes both ways and basically wore out his Underarmour Mid's. These shoes have been a good emergency replacement for about 1/3 the cost.
